  • I am unable to connect to wifi because my sign into icloud screen reappears every 2 seconds

    I am having trouble connecting to wifi because my sign into icloud screen reappears every 2 seconds, knocking it back offline. It won't take my correct password.  What do I do?

    Try:
    - Reset the iOS device. Nothing will be lost      
    Reset iOS device: Hold down the On/Off button and the Home button at the same time for at
    least ten seconds, until the Apple logo appears.
    - Reset all settings  (if you can)                          
    Go to Settings > General > Reset and tap Reset All Settings.
    All your preferences and settings are reset. Information (such as contacts and calendars) and media (such as songs and videos) aren’t affected.
    - Restore from backup. See:                                               
    iOS: Back up and restore your iOS device with iCloud or iTunes
    - Restore to factory settings/new iOS device.

  • Your screen name ***** is now signed into AIM from 2 locations

    IChat keeps popping up this message:
    Your screen name *** is now
    signed into AOL(R) Instant
    Messenger in 2 locations. To sign
    off the other location(s), reply to
    this message with the number 1.
    I do use my iChat account on two computers, but I am never logged in from two machines at the same time. I get this message even if I have iChat running on only one machine.
    It used to happen occasionally and I would just type "1" and that was an end to it for a while. Now it is beginning to happen repeatedly. I type "1" and about 5 minutes later I receive the same message again.
    My screen name in the message is slightly garbled. It has an "(" on the front and the last character is replaced with a smiley. Mean anything?
    The option in iChat preferences "Allow multiple logins for this account" is checked and greyed out. I have another AOL Instant Messenger account which doesn't give me the same problems. This one also has that option checked, but its not greyed out.
    My first worry is that this is a symptom of someone trying to hack my system via iChat? But if not I would like to stop it happening while still being able to use this iChat account from more than one computer (but only one computer at a time)
    If anyone has encountered this problem and knows if it can easily be fixed I'd be grateful.
    Thanks very much

    Specifically using the Logout option on the AIM web pages does in fact log you out.
    It is when you just close the window /tab to the page that their Setting take effect.
    If you are set at "When I quit iChat, Set my Status to Off Line" that will also log you out fully when you Quit iChat.
    There are some Oddities that can cause this without a second location or computer being used. (well not directly).
    Are you doing Internet Sharing from this Mac to another computer or a cell phone ?
    This can cause a sort or Loop via the other computer to the internet and iChat can see the Internet twice. I have also seen this with iChat and an iPhone using Internet sharing. (Instead of being wirelss to the wireless router the person had used the Airport Card to Share the Mac's Internet connection thinking it would lead to better syncing).
    Also are you using the AOL Mail Servers and logging in from Mail (every thirty Minutes) to get your New Mail ?
    Are you using a MIMO routing device as iChat can see these as two or More connection to the Internet.
    DO you have another AIM based Instant Message app ? (AdiumX or ProteusX)
    Do you have an AIM transport set up for a Jabber Buddy List ?

  • Sign in to itunes store will not disappear and the whole IPad will not let me go into other screens till this pop up goes away.  I have entered the password several times and still will not disappear.  Turned the IPad on and off but the pop up remain

    sign in to itunes store will not disappear and the whole IPad will not let me go into other screens till this pop up goes away.  I have entered the password several times and still will not disappear.  Turned the IPad on and off but the pop up remain

    FIrst try a soft reset by holding down the home & sleep/wake buttons until the Apple logo appears then let go & let the iPad boot up normally. 
    If that doesn't help then to make sure you have a strong internet connection.
    Try resetting Network Settings
    Settings->General->Reset->Reset Network Settings,
    You won't lose any data but will have to log back into your wifi networks.
    Once logged back in and when the pop-up appears, try entering your password again.
